REGULATIONS FOR A 11FR-S 11 DISTRICT: The following regulations shal_l apply in a "FR-5 11 S ,-"o-c, , , ~ _, •• ~·· •-s, ,-• , • District. (A) USES PE RMI TED: 1. Single-family dwellings, including mobile homes. 2. Agricultural uses: a. Keeping and raising small animals for domestic use, including dogs, cats, and household pets, poultry and other birds, bees, fish, worms, and frogs. b. Keeping, raising, aJ1d pasturing of live- stock provided that the following lot or parcel areas shall be required for each animal raised or kept on the premises: 1. For each horse or head of cattle over one (1) year of age--eight thousand one hundred twenty-five (S, 12 5) square feet. 2. For each head of swine over ten (10) ·weeks of age --eight thousand one hlu1dred twenty-five (8,125) square feet. 3. For each head of sheep or goats--two thousaJ1d (2,000) square feet. c. Raising and harvesting trees, fruit, grain., flo1·rer s, herbs, and other plan ts and f oocl. crops. d. Display and sale of agricultural goods produced on the premises. -4 - l 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 1.8 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 e. Necessary accessory uses, not including .storage an.d. processil1.g of goo.els from non-. aclj acen t i and or 1 and un.der· different 01mcr.:. ship. 3. !1·Ii!1 i11g and excavating except as 1 in1i ted in B. l. 4. Protection of land and forests from fire, erosion, floods, slides, quakes, insects, diseases, and pollution, including arboretums and natural, ex- perimental and study areas. 5, Pedestrian, equestrian, and bicycle trails. 6. Agricultural and forestry experimental areas. 7. Home occupations: a. Sale of arts and crafts, goods, and services produced on the premises. b. All home occupations shall be subject to the following conditions: 1. Home occupations are considered to be accessory to the residential use and are permitted only when the proprietor resides on the premises. 2. Not more than one (1) employee or assistant may be engaged for work or service on the premises in connection with such uses. 3. Advertising displays shall be limited to one tu1lighted sign of not more than six (6) square feet of display area. Such sign shall -5- l 2 3 4 6 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 not be located in any required yard. 8. Accessory uses and buildings customary and pertinent tci"'"perrilitfii"d uses, "iriclliding g1iest houses, hBrns; shops, garages, and storage areas. (B) THE FOLLOWING USES SUBJECT TO SECURING A USE PERMIT IN EACH CASE. 1. Home occupations, mining, and excavating which might be objectionable because of noise, odor, smoke, dust, bright light, vibration, pollution, traffic congestion, unsightly storage areas, mater- ials or equipment, the handling of explosives or dangerous materials, or the storage of one hundred (100) or more galons of inflammable fluids. 2. Commercial kennels and animal hospitals on sites not less than five (5) acres. 3. Private or commercial outdoor recreational facili- ties on sites not less than five (5) acres, in- cluding but not limited to golf courses, recreation- a 1 clubs, riding academies and st ables, hunting lodges and camps, boat ramps, and campgrounds. 4. Public and quasi-public uses including schools, parks, museums, meeting halls, libraries, and government offices. -6 - l 2 3 4 6 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 (C) Lot Area: 1Iinimum. required area for .. a lot per resid.e:ritial. dwelling unit shall not be less than five (5) acres for "FR-S't, (D) Lot Width: Minimum required lot width shall not be less than two hundred twenty (2 2 0) feet, except ·when adj oini!1g a major road or creek, the minimum frontage shall not be less than three hundred (300) feet. (E) Front Yard: Minimum front yard shall be fifty (50) feet from the centerline of the road, except w;iere the road is classified by the county as a Federal Aid Secondary Road, the minimum building setback requirement shall be fifty-five (55) feet from the centerline of said road. (F) Side Yard: Minimum required side building setback shall be not less than ten (10) feet :for 11FR-Srt. (G) Rear Yard: Minimum required rear building setback shall be not less than ten (10) feet for 11FR-5 11 • SECTION 3.
